Job Summary and Qualifications
This position is responsible for assuring the Quality activities of the Medical Staff are in accordance with regulatory, corporate policy, and other Medical Staff requirements. This includes but is not limited to the Focused and Ongoing Professional Practice Evaluation process and the Professional Practice Evaluation Process (peer review). These processes are inclusive of all credentialed providers, both physicians and advanced practice practitioners.
In collaboration with Medical Staff Department Chairs and the Medical Staff Credentialing Department, ensures clinical and professional competency at the time of initial appointment, additional privileges, re-credentialing or when clinical concerns are identified. Collaborates with the Director of Professional Practice Evaluation (PPE Director) to facilitate the on-going professional practice evaluation process. Generates reports, analyzes data for variance, performs clinical reviews of threshold variances and formulates plan of action if indicated, with the PPE Director.
Directly facilitates the Professional Practice Evaluation peer review process including initial review of reported concerns or cases triggered for review by established mechanisms. Independently facilities designated Clinical Specialty Review Committees, educates, supports, and advises Committee Chairs and Committee members. Fosters a culture of learning that results in professional performance improvement.
